This course is designed to encourage students to lean into the history of ceramics and to explore ways to utilize historical forms as inspiration for new work. Students are invited to bring images of historical works that inspire them. Working on wheels and tabletops, we will explore strategies and techniques for creating functional pots. Conversations and demonstrations will help students create dynamic forms and explore approaches to surface using texture, carving, and a variety of slip decoration techniques.
